A comparison of absorbed doses from medical cobalt beams was performed by means of thermoluminescent dosimeters at all radiotherapeutic workplaces in Czechoslovakia. At most workplaces (58%) the deviation from the reference primary etalon placed at the Institute of Radiation Dosimetry of the Czechoslovak Academy of Sciences was below 3%. Neither of the workplaces exhibited deviation higher than 5%, indicating a good level of clinical dosimetry.

The demands of a busy clinic require that basic machine calculations be performed as accurately, rapidly and simply as possible. Simple method of predicting X-ray and electron beam output factors for rectangular field sizes on machines that have collimation similar to the CGR Saturne 2+ have been described. The calculated field output factors for rectangular and square field sizes were in agreement with measured data to within +/- 1% for all energies.
